EC Number | Metals/Ions | Comment | Organism | Structure |
---|---|---|---|---|
2.7.7.43 | Co2+ | the enzyme can function with a broad range of metal cofactors like Zn2+, Fe2+, Co2+ and Mn2+ | Drosophila melanogaster | |
2.7.7.43 | Fe2+ | the enzyme can function with a broad range of metal cofactors like Zn2+, Fe2+, Co2+ and Mn2+ | Drosophila melanogaster | |
2.7.7.43 | Mg2+ | the activity of the enzyme with Mg2+ is low, 20 mM Mg2+ is used in assay conditions | Drosophila melanogaster | |
2.7.7.43 | Mn2+ | the enzyme can function with a broad range of metal cofactors like Zn2+, Fe2+, Co2+ and Mn2+ | Drosophila melanogaster | |
2.7.7.43 | Zn2+ | the enzyme can function with a broad range of metal cofactors like Zn2+, Fe2+, Co2+ and Mn2+ | Drosophila melanogaster |

EC Number | Substrates | Comment Substrates | Organism | Products | Comment (Products) | Rev. | Reac. |
---|---|---|---|---|---|---|---|
2.7.7.43 | CTP + N-acetylneuraminic acid | - |
Drosophila melanogaster | diphosphate + CMP-N-acetylneuraminic acid | - |
? | |
2.7.7.43 | CTP + N-acetylneuraminic acid | the enzyme displays specificity for N-acetylneuraminic acid as a substrate | Drosophila melanogaster | diphosphate + CMP-N-acetylneuraminic acid | - |
? | |
2.7.7.43 | CTP + N-glycolneuraminate | relatively inferior substrate | Drosophila melanogaster | diphosphate + CMP-N-glycolneuraminate | - |
? | |
2.7.7.43 | CTP + sialic acid | - |
Drosophila melanogaster | diphosphate + CMP-sialic acid | - |
? | |
2.7.7.43 | additional information | ATP, GTP and UTP, along with CDP and CMP cannot be used as substrates. The enzyme has a nearly undetectable activity toward 2-keto-3-deoxynononic acid and 2-keto-3-deoxyoctonic acid while no activity is detected with 3-deoxy-D-manno-2-octulosonic acid | Drosophila melanogaster | ? | - |

EC Number | Temperature Minimum [°C] | Temperature Maximum [°C] | Comment | Organism |
---|---|---|---|---|
2.7.7.43 | 20 | 45 | the enzyme activity steadily increases with temperature from 20 C to 45 C by approximately an order of magnitude. The activity declines dramatically at temperatures above 45 C | Drosophila melanogaster |

EC Number | pH Minimum | pH Maximum | Comment | Organism |
---|---|---|---|---|
2.7.7.43 | 6.5 | 9 | the enzyme has a relatively narrow optimum around pH 8.0. In standard assay conditions, the enzyme activity declines precipitously at lower pH, dropping to 20% around pH 7.4 and becoming practically negligible below pH 7.0. The enzyme activity also declines substantially but more gradually, losing around 50% at pH 9.0. The enzyme exhibits significant activity at pH 6.5 in the presence of Mn2+, Co2+, Zn2+, Fe2+ and Ni2+ | Drosophila melanogaster |
